**Core Concept**
Transrectal ultrasonography (TRUS) is a diagnostic imaging technique that utilizes high-frequency sound waves to produce detailed images of the prostate gland and surrounding tissues. This modality is particularly useful for evaluating the prostate gland's size, shape, and texture, as well as detecting abnormalities such as tumors or nodules.
